Final Recommendation

Both Cognito Health and Boston Children's AI system require contacting for pricing information, so neither offers transparent upfront costs or a free tier for evaluation. This makes it difficult to compare affordability directly, and both require a sales conversation to understand total cost of ownership. Neither tool appears to emphasize public API access based on available information, suggesting they may be more limited to their specific use cases or require custom integration arrangements.

Cognito Health excels as a broad workflow optimization platform, automating documentation and patient engagement across general clinical settings while integrating with existing EHR systems. Its strength lies in reducing administrative burden for busy clinicians across multiple specialties. Boston Children's AI system, by contrast, is purpose-built for a narrower but critical use case—identifying rare and complex pediatric diagnoses by analyzing patient data to surface possibilities clinicians might miss, improving diagnostic accuracy where it matters most.

Pick Cognito Health if you're looking to streamline daily clinical workflows and reduce documentation burden across your organization. Pick Boston Children's AI approach if your primary need is improving diagnostic accuracy for rare or complex pediatric cases, though note this system appears hospital-specific rather than available as a standalone product for other institutions.
